How To Cancel A Friend Request On Facebook Using A Computer?

  • Get yourself logged into your Facebook account on a browser on a Mac or Personal Computer. Find and tap the icon that resembles 2 individuals in the upper-right corner of the page.
  • Find “See All” way down on the drop-down menu that reveals your friend requests (if there are any) plus recommendations for people to friend on Facebook.
  • Tap “View Sent Requests” way up on the new page that will be visible.
  • On the next page, a list of all the friend requests you have sent will be visible. Select the specific friend request you want to cancel by moving your cursor over the “Friend Request Sent.” tab. Choose “Cancel Request” from the dropdown menu to rescind your friend request to the owner of the account.

How To Cancel A Friend Request On Facebook Using A Mobile Phone?

Even if you can only cancel friend requests but heading into every individual’s Facebook page on the mobile application, it is also possible to get yourself logged into the Facebook site on a browser on your smartphone to cancel friend requests the same way you do on a desktop. To make it happen, just:

  • Log in to Facebook.com on your Android or iOS device.
  • Tap the icon that looks like a silhouette of two individuals.
  • As soon as your friend requests are shown, tap the down arrow located to the right side of the Friend Request tab then tap “View Sent Requests.” Users can switch between sent and received requests by tapping the down arrow.
